Adornes Estate
From Feb 5, 2022

Simply Photography Exhibition by Willy Vynck at Adornes Estate

Striking black and white contemporary art in Bruges.

See Willy Vynck's photographic collection focusing on the understated elegance of everyday reality. Hosted at Adornes Estate, these black and white images reveal form, shadow, and silent human interactions.

Adornes Estate
From Jan 28, 2023

Explore the Backstage Photographic Exhibition at Adornes Estate, Bruges

Archival photography mapping 150 years of historic estate life.

Witness the physical and social transformations of this historic Bruges landmark. This exhibition showcases archival photographs of chapel restorations, family celebrations, and the daily activities of past residents.

Adornes Estate
From May 14, 2022

Melancholy: Poetry of the Mind Exhibition at Adornes Estate

Contemporary art reflecting on creative genius and loss.

This exhibition, hosted at the Adornes Estate's historic Jerusalem Chapel, reconsiders the multifaceted nature of melancholy. Viewers can contemplate various paintings and contemporary works that challenge modern taboos surrounding sorrow, introspection, and creative drive.

Adornes Estate
From Apr 29, 2023

Jean De Groote Art Exhibition at Adornes Estate

Minimalist paintings exploring existence and the metaphysics of being.

Experience a series of twenty quiet, minimalist still-life works by Jean De Groote. Set against the historic backdrop of the Jerusalem Chapel, these paintings prompt deep contemplation of the visible and invisible aspects of daily existence.

Concertgebouw Circuit
From Jan 28, 2024

In Full Growth Exhibition at Concertgebouw Circuit in Bruges

Flo Vandenbussche's five-year environmental photography project.

View the evolving story of the Concertgebouw Forest through annual photographic portraits. This ongoing installation by visual artist Flo Vandenbussche documents environmental growth on the outskirts of Bruges.
